运维

运维

Products

当前位置:首页 > 运维 >

Postman Linux版如何通过实现数据验证?

96SEO 2025-07-29 11:32 4


Postman Linux版简介

Postman是一款流行的API测试工具, 它能帮开发者轻巧松地测试、监控和文档化API。Linux版Postman给了丰有钱的功能, 包括但不限于求发送、响应琢磨、周围变量管理、测试脚本编写等。本文将沉点介绍怎么在Postman Linux版中实现数据验证。

Postman Linux版安装与启动

  1. 下载Postman Linux版安装包,比方说Postman-9.19.3-linux-x64.tar.gz。
  2. 解压安装包到指定目录,比方说/home/user/postman。
  3. 在终端中进入Postman安装目录,运行命令./postman启动Postman。

数据验证基础

在Postman中,数据验证基本上通过以下几种方式实现: 1. 检查响应体中是不是包含特定字符串。 2. 检查响应体是不是等于预期字符串。 3. 检查响应时候是不是在合理范围内。 4. 检查HTTP状态码是不是正确。 5. 检查响应头是不是包含特定字段。

Postman Linux版如何进行数据验证

周围变量管理

周围变量在Postman中用于存储和管理测试数据。在Linux版Postman中, 你能通过以下步骤创建和管理周围变量: 1. 在Postman中,选择“Environment”选项卡。 2. 点击“Add New Environment”按钮,创建新鲜的周围。 3. 在“Name”字段中输入周围名称,比方说“dev”。 4. 在“Variables”有些, 添加需要的周围变量及其值,比方说: - Name: username - Value: admin 5. 点击“Save”按钮保存周围。

测试脚本编写

Postman支持用JavaScript编写测试脚本, 用于处理响应数据、断言验证等。

javascript const getAPIResponseStatus = parseInt); const getAPIResponseData = JSON.parse);

test { expect.toBe; });

test { const data = getAPIResponseData; expect.toEqual; });

用数据文件

在Postman中,你能创建CSV或JSON文件来存储测试数据。

csv username,password user1,pass1 user2,pass2

在测试脚本中,用{{var}}来引用数据文件中的字段:

javascript const username = {{username}}; const password = {{password}};

用集合运行器

集合运行器能帮你批量运行测试集合。以下步骤说明怎么用集合运行器:

  1. 在Postman中,选择“Runner”选项卡。
  2. 选择要运行的集合和周围。
  3. 在“Iterations”字段中输入要运行的次数。
  4. 在“Data”字段中输入JSON对象或数组,包含全部要测试的数据集。
  5. 点击“Start Runner”按钮,开头运行测试集合。

验证技巧

  1. 检查响应体中是不是包含字符串:用contains
  2. 检查响应体是不是等于字符串:用equals
  3. 检查响应时候:用responseTime <200
  4. 检查状态码:用status === 200
  5. 检查状态码名称包含特定字符串:用contains
  6. 设置周围变量/全局变量:用set
  7. XML转JSON:用xml2Json
  8. 检查JSON的值:用equals

,确保API的稳稳当当性和可靠性。希望本文对你有所帮。


标签: Linux

提交需求或反馈

Demand feedback